The skill is a disclosed academic reading-group workflow that reads user-selected papers and writes markdown notes, with no evidence of hidden or harmful behavior.

Install only if you want a multi-agent reading-group workflow rather than a simple paper summary. Use a fresh output folder for each run, avoid placing unrelated private files in that folder, and review intermediate notes/citations before relying on the final synthesis.

Vague Triggers

Medium
Confidence
88% confidence
Finding
The description says the skill triggers on requests to "analyze academic literature" or "synthesize research across multiple sources," which are broad phrases that can overlap with many ordinary research-assistance requests. The file does not provide narrowing conditions or negative examples to clarify when the virtual reading group should be invoked instead of a simpler literature-analysis skill.
